CURRICULUM DESIGN/BASIC PROGRAM CHAPTER I PRE-SCHOOL EDUCATION
The Board shall provide Pre-School instruction designed to serve students ages three and four. The purpose of such instruction shall be to create a happy, productive, and successful school experience for young children and to prepare them for their regular school careers in a positive manner.

Those present and future rules and regulations set forth by Chapter I regulations, which have implications for Pre-School programming, shall be adhered to. Only children in Chapter I target area schools shall be eligible.

The Chapter I Pre-School program shall be an integral part of the regular school program, on a space-available basis, in all elementary Chapter I target area schools. The program shall function with modifications, in accordance with the regular school calendar established for the district. Classes shall be scheduled on a half-day basis.

Montessori Pre-School experience shall be provided for those students in the district who have differing ethnic, social, racial, and economic backgrounds so they might interact in an instructional setting designed to provide specific learning experiences in an enhanced academic environment. Requirements mandated by the federal court order relative to space, population, and general procedures shall be met.

In order to achieve integration of Pre-School instruction into the regular elementary program of the district, planning and development of the Pre-School program shall be included in the development of the regular kindergarten and elementary school curriculum.

The Board regards parental involvement as an important component of the district's Pre-School program and shall encourage such involvement through conferences, home visitations, and classroom participation by parents.
